What is considered a dry measuring cup?

What is a Dry Measuring Cup? A dry measuring cup (often sold in nested sets of 4 cups or more) is designed to fill to the brim with the dry ingredient. There is little worry about sloshing ingredients over the side when you’re measuring flour or sugar.

Are wet measurements the same as dry?

Unfortunately, although a liquid measure and a dry one actually hold the same volume, the manner in which we measure dry versus wet ingredients greatly differs, and thus the cups are anything but interchangeable.

How do you measure dry ingredients? Dry ingredients (like flour and sugar) should be measured using flat-cup measures. Ingredients should be level. Running the back of a flat-bladed knife across the surface is a good way to do this. Spoon measures must be measured with the correct sized spoons.

How do you measure a dry ounce?

The convention in the US is this: If a dry ingredient is listed in ounces, it’s a unit of weight and should be measured on a scale. If a wet ingredient is listed in ounces, it’s fluid ounces and should be measured in a wet measuring cup.

How much is a 1 cup?

“1 Cup” is equal to 8 fluid ounces in US Standard Volume. It is a measure used in cooking. A Metric Cup is slightly different: it is 250 milliliters (which is about 8.5 fluid ounces).

How can I measure 4 oz of flour without scales? How to measure flour without a scale

  1. Step 1: use a spoon or scoop to fluff the flour in your bag or jar.
  2. Step 2: use a spoon to scoop the flour into your measuring cup until it’s completely full.
  3. Step 3: use the flat end of a knife to level the flour off on the top of the measuring cup.

How do you measure dry ounces without a scale?

USE HOUSEHOLD OBJECTS TO GUESSTIMATE

  1. 1/4 cup is roughly the same size as an egg.
  2. A tennis ball is about 1/2 cup.
  3. A softball is around 2 cups.
  4. A three-ounce steak is around the same size as a deck of cards.
  5. One ounce of cheese is three dice.
  6. A baseball is around the same size as 1/2 cup of pasta or rice.

When measuring dry ingredients do you need? Follow These Steps

  1. Fill measuring cup until it overflows. Spoon flour or other light, powdery dry ingredient into your measuring cup until it domes up over the top.
  2. Level it off with the back of a knife.
  3. Fill measuring spoon.
  4. Level it off with the back of a knife.
